Handover: Nightly search reindex for Quellbird catalog now runs at 02:15 instead of 01:00 to avoid overlapping the Marlowe export job. If the reindex stalls, restart the indexer pod and re-trigger from the Ops console. Support can do this without paging us. To unlock the indexer recovery vault, use the passphrase below.

recovery phrase for bajef-yagag: zordor-casok-tammir

Handover Note — Director Transition, Operations

For the board: handing the Tillbrae plant capacity question to incoming Director Maren Oskew. Status: second line approved in principle, funding unreleased pending Q4 demand read. Risks: Corvane order book softening, tooling quotes expire in six weeks. Recommendation on file favors phased expansion. Maren has full context from three transition sessions. The confidential note below states the underlying plan.

board note of tawig-bajof: The renewal with Ralixix Holdings closes at $10 million a year, 20 percent above the last contract. Project Druix slips by two quarters because of the tooling delay.

Since the Marloway 4.2 upgrade, the Quillstone planner prefers nested-loop joins on mid-sized tables, regressing several dashboard queries by 10–40x. Root cause is the new cardinality estimator undercounting rows after correlated filters. As an interim fix we pin the estimator's behavior with explicit overrides rather than reverting the upgrade, which the Hollis team needs for partition pruning. The overrides below are applied at session start by the gateway and should be treated as frozen pending the 4.3 fix.

constants for hahip-hafog:
WEIGHTS = {
    "feniel": 55,
    "kasox": 667,
}

Team — EXIF scrubbing is now enforced on all uploads in Brindlecote. GPS, serial numbers, and maker notes are stripped at ingest; orientation is preserved. Old images are being backfilled this week, ETA Friday. Flag regressions in the media channel before the eng sync. The build token for the rollout follows below.

build token for tawip-yageg: htk9_92ac43d42